wisdom
n.
Old English wisdom "knowledge, learning, experience," from wis (see wise, adj.) + -dom. A common Germanic compound (Old Saxon, Old Frisian wisdom, Old Norse visdomr, Old High German wistuom "wisdom," German Weistum "judicial sentence serving as a precedent"). Wisdom teeth so called from 1848 (earlier teeth of wisdom, 1660s), a loan-translation of Latin dentes sapientiae, itself a loan-translation of Greek sophronisteres (used by Hippocrates, from sophron "prudent, self-controlled"), so called because they usually appear ages 17-25, when a person reaches adulthood.

〔李〕[wis( ←wise)a. 有智慧的;-dom ⇒“the fact or act of being wise有智慧的事实或行为”→] n.①wise knowledge and judgement智慧,明智
